Michelle Renee Cuellar
Birth date: Oct 18, 1983 Death date: Jan 24, 2015
Michelle Renee Cuellar of San Antonio, Texas, born October 18, 1983 in Gainesville, Florida passed away Saturday, January 24, 2015. She is preceded in death by her son, Antonio Cuellar and mother, Betty Jean Bouchard. She is survi Read Obituary